Table D.1

Comparison between analytical and numerical solutions for the changes in central instants.

Mutual Change in tc Relative

approx. analytical (s) numerical (s) error (–)
1 2.17458 2.17455 7.84 × 10−6
2 36.7842 36.7824 4.85 × 10−5
3 73.9007 73.8972 4.76 × 10−5
4 94.9994 94.9951 4.56 × 10−5
5 111.043 111.038 4.74 × 10−5
6 132.098 132.092 4.55 × 10−5
7 169.169 169.161 4.55 × 10−5
8 203.983 203.974 4.58 × 10−5
9 206.006 206.198 9.30 × 10−4
10 241.156 241.145 4.53 × 10−5
11 261.643 261.631 4.35 × 10−5
12 278.322 278.309 4.51 × 10−5
13 298.557 298.544 4.21 × 10−5
14 335.416 335.403 4.04 × 10−5
15 371.133 371.117 4.27 × 10−5
16 372.219 372.205 3.84 × 10−5
17 408.219 408.202 4.23 × 10−5
18 445.273 445.254 4.21 × 10−5
19 464.009 463.996 2.82 × 10−5
20 482.288 482.267 4.21 × 10−5

Notes. This table compares the analytical and numerical solutions for the changes in central instants after applying a small variation (0.001%) in the initial states of Io, Europa and the Earth. Analytical approximations of the changes are derived from the central instants partials provided in Sect. 2.3. Results are here only reported for the 20 first mutual approximations detected in 2020 (although verification was conducted over 200 observations).
